mirror of
https://github.com/Mbed-TLS/mbedtls.git
synced 2025-04-16 08:42:50 +00:00
Add some test RSA keys of sizes 768 and up
These are sufficiently large for PKCS#1v1.5 signature with SHA-512 or SHA3-512. Cover some non-word-aligned sizes. Signed-off-by: Gilles Peskine <Gilles.Peskine@arm.com>
This commit is contained in:
parent
dfb7afe67e
commit
0a2d48290b
@ -706,8 +706,24 @@ keys_rsa_basic_pwd = testkey
|
|||||||
### Password used for PKCS8-encoded encrypted RSA keys
|
### Password used for PKCS8-encoded encrypted RSA keys
|
||||||
keys_rsa_pkcs8_pwd = PolarSSLTest
|
keys_rsa_pkcs8_pwd = PolarSSLTest
|
||||||
|
|
||||||
### Basic 1024-, 2048- and 4096-bit unencrypted RSA keys from which
|
### Basic unencrypted RSA keys from which
|
||||||
### all other encrypted RSA keys are derived.
|
### all other encrypted RSA keys are derived.
|
||||||
|
keys_rsa_base =
|
||||||
|
rsa_pkcs1_768_clear.pem:
|
||||||
|
$(OPENSSL) genrsa -out $@ 768
|
||||||
|
keys_rsa_base += rsa_pkcs1_768_clear.pem
|
||||||
|
rsa_pkcs1_769_clear.pem:
|
||||||
|
$(OPENSSL) genrsa -out $@ 769
|
||||||
|
keys_rsa_base += rsa_pkcs1_769_clear.pem
|
||||||
|
rsa_pkcs1_770_clear.pem:
|
||||||
|
$(OPENSSL) genrsa -out $@ 770
|
||||||
|
keys_rsa_base += rsa_pkcs1_770_clear.pem
|
||||||
|
rsa_pkcs1_776_clear.pem:
|
||||||
|
$(OPENSSL) genrsa -out $@ 776
|
||||||
|
keys_rsa_base += rsa_pkcs1_776_clear.pem
|
||||||
|
rsa_pkcs1_784_clear.pem:
|
||||||
|
$(OPENSSL) genrsa -out $@ 784
|
||||||
|
keys_rsa_base += rsa_pkcs1_784_clear.pem
|
||||||
rsa_pkcs1_1024_clear.pem:
|
rsa_pkcs1_1024_clear.pem:
|
||||||
$(OPENSSL) genrsa -out $@ 1024
|
$(OPENSSL) genrsa -out $@ 1024
|
||||||
keys_rsa_base += rsa_pkcs1_1024_clear.pem
|
keys_rsa_base += rsa_pkcs1_1024_clear.pem
|
||||||
|
BIN
tests/data_files/rsa_pkcs1_768_clear.der
Normal file
BIN
tests/data_files/rsa_pkcs1_768_clear.der
Normal file
Binary file not shown.
13
tests/data_files/rsa_pkcs1_768_clear.pem
Normal file
13
tests/data_files/rsa_pkcs1_768_clear.pem
Normal file
@ -0,0 +1,13 @@
|
|||||||
|
-----BEGIN PRIVATE KEY-----
|
||||||
|
MIIB5QIBADANBgkqhkiG9w0BAQEFAASCAc8wggHLAgEAAmEA2YljoU8MXSipAQkJ
|
||||||
|
KtPH57N8JTyoHo3AXZKqumGGFEUJhoyIp6BtFUHikLGMasMzaK7CUzLZComjhNJP
|
||||||
|
gyAxsrjh8bt8eKn4iEP+UkB9KwvnpkrPdP22WiDhUUbKckvXAgMBAAECYQCMHTYS
|
||||||
|
3Dt2dY4FoLBK6YXE85Ju2ZbftyXEH4ff7JjTzXPJOhN7BJW+L2WjFPkAeyEdi3Y/
|
||||||
|
5zrKVtRQRXpmELeYOpgxy5CZfmknYyForhNwKKGL14GFE4/O50nbsnHzjAECMQD0
|
||||||
|
IqQbfR334+BtSn4qczFm5q8QbhTjkQMRQ4bn4xGBKdGU/PwmyJj5DpF54FoRmIEC
|
||||||
|
MQDkG9OgZo8VKRsVPUeJXjMQQNChes1Q7+W8A/qnt8IuHaedohEjC4fDFNSEbyl7
|
||||||
|
eFcCMQDMokC2PeChySNz2G36fQXav9/bwLnHqeRNUzHAKwegIYJoBMoCZEA8+uYb
|
||||||
|
p183woECMBzA2TM92klbjhtmRw8svZkN4n6IYTsTkkzZ342mnyZ6/HblR+239VwE
|
||||||
|
0ykCbiMvLwIwcJxV2F1UXJ2wvwNJhGdYPzHW2fWelsB7KIwcHHKEMX0Q/WZ7usQe
|
||||||
|
8nhaXrUdJdA0
|
||||||
|
-----END PRIVATE KEY-----
|
BIN
tests/data_files/rsa_pkcs1_769_clear.der
Normal file
BIN
tests/data_files/rsa_pkcs1_769_clear.der
Normal file
Binary file not shown.
13
tests/data_files/rsa_pkcs1_769_clear.pem
Normal file
13
tests/data_files/rsa_pkcs1_769_clear.pem
Normal file
@ -0,0 +1,13 @@
|
|||||||
|
-----BEGIN PRIVATE KEY-----
|
||||||
|
MIIB5gIBADANBgkqhkiG9w0BAQEFAASCAdAwggHMAgEAAmEBtTOp1rud7hQbMLrQ
|
||||||
|
2Q0BfF7CX+XtflbWxy9ZBUpuyGxJCgdw4+PXZGa64DaxHozNM3EHGxvnYc1uuWpl
|
||||||
|
g3kvTu5qfAzZuKjnGXVIVc3aneHMTYQeUzWcGrSxJdtfhRr5AgMBAAECYQDVGAxU
|
||||||
|
/HdannQuSTAYSu2JeApXgZNDPAJNbXd/S6s5hwYGnF/aw6etaSD2vdGQqWDblwjk
|
||||||
|
hUxvweEe2bCobFuYXTzO7l7glvfNpHn2VOy44SFW51YG1JGyJ3qpm6DQ+30CMQG8
|
||||||
|
3YQ7tWfTExA+mE7AxHuG1XPHGwANEEeZL7WmmkIUs6nCpUM5tyeXelXDbAZ3c9MC
|
||||||
|
MQD7lwqpfq18pTA1Hzz+6sAaD5Pdiyo2zi3m3ke4azsCxiPTENNO8cSwjBqi8ITA
|
||||||
|
EoMCMFJMOJZDLP3jXPH3gzouHxwGiPCgkhXYmSZBqT009FyYECOuJw2aUHy5aPxK
|
||||||
|
E7gteQIxAOPRzRzYkh6JstKXu/MV/ehbbMkzqIFCSHyDkaxkpWYIqA4LcV1OPo6j
|
||||||
|
/8bGR19qIwIxAaxBZhV5njcSqf5lhJ5ftLMWiXQEzKO8pdOkLOeqT35zVPzpz0LD
|
||||||
|
ZF3/s0smY+YZHg==
|
||||||
|
-----END PRIVATE KEY-----
|
BIN
tests/data_files/rsa_pkcs1_770_clear.der
Normal file
BIN
tests/data_files/rsa_pkcs1_770_clear.der
Normal file
Binary file not shown.
13
tests/data_files/rsa_pkcs1_770_clear.pem
Normal file
13
tests/data_files/rsa_pkcs1_770_clear.pem
Normal file
@ -0,0 +1,13 @@
|
|||||||
|
-----BEGIN PRIVATE KEY-----
|
||||||
|
MIIB5wIBADANBgkqhkiG9w0BAQEFAASCAdEwggHNAgEAAmEDS2vbf8jg+A02Gcl2
|
||||||
|
91UaWDaGIAopYPuRhxcYRmA+pPJjWtU0Pyqiojuf0gmILgDSX43uVlx4ZWi0yP90
|
||||||
|
9jUNMxZPTU2wQleHjuVAk10eGknKxnKh2YX43vWyy1zaLKcxAgMBAAECYQEY6b+d
|
||||||
|
/AYSGDRgul1JW6r+nopluXy2tJNv7x1Cs2OqBKFa65APSeAJMNq2Vj5pNBOnzaHK
|
||||||
|
NPv4S0Z/HOh8DylYdJXW6+4lVZqYrLwC1XVhejmVERnKNOB0nO4qPAjHTQECMQHh
|
||||||
|
c8/cL9618nOYJwJigr5NiNIJ1h0htUhllNHzGBqtQG7YrN50p9x1HQfzKSVGnGkC
|
||||||
|
MQHAd7y2zJenNtfwTR976ooaun+FZ6ixOF3ctuFg37o1WzthSS2EgIlrhNl8LmrI
|
||||||
|
+4kCMQHE62NO+8WjGwv9xizrKZ4HaMBXOpM7Q8Rws5jy/OkTtXrR4YaA7e1qSz5Q
|
||||||
|
VZPYookCMQCEIYMjZKIl7R2wOjjVfKPV/i7GMmVcWZwmBGfg7+ngAJI9Np9Hk8tp
|
||||||
|
N0oQsWha8OkCMQF4Y76OsODPpqgnt6RrwkzEBYe5ubRQ+yvskgthKzFWIkVYhUbA
|
||||||
|
iCclTg3LxTkuF9I=
|
||||||
|
-----END PRIVATE KEY-----
|
BIN
tests/data_files/rsa_pkcs1_776_clear.der
Normal file
BIN
tests/data_files/rsa_pkcs1_776_clear.der
Normal file
Binary file not shown.
13
tests/data_files/rsa_pkcs1_776_clear.pem
Normal file
13
tests/data_files/rsa_pkcs1_776_clear.pem
Normal file
@ -0,0 +1,13 @@
|
|||||||
|
-----BEGIN PRIVATE KEY-----
|
||||||
|
MIIB6AIBADANBgkqhkiG9w0BAQEFAASCAdIwggHOAgEAAmIA2ddFQYzrl74kgTjz
|
||||||
|
Pwv1/FaIisF994XKewWKHiWEWsiWJN/74nJH3yVHxMYs7THYKix9v689xfv5s12+
|
||||||
|
o6fernc1xhgWeKHsa40d4L8ECwjpzkfYdPdHDcsIk8GT/JeEWwIDAQABAmE//F1Z
|
||||||
|
Xb0tuyoZ0tKQKEE+t2Qv7ZnEhMXu0Le7FyYDTHvdpPTllM/LmbW09MjpewSM4eVk
|
||||||
|
2RhSSp5sJICT4nCiLx4yOqR6OvLtH3ZIETG9HGFLFiQWJjczUDFQ7WSb1BlhAjEP
|
||||||
|
PbkpPmmN2deZxeifjCOymWYqVVdGjLXUKO6Qstksgz7AtbSeGKSzQKys1jpVNwvT
|
||||||
|
AjEOSwEInewxEpBxRb8wuaitMdO9XmKtoqthLkDR7ftjiL+DdUQmvNZpOvUWkowz
|
||||||
|
APhZAjEI73Dco0CS70IdXw/waeKL1K825m2SaPA4//5NSu1T0WY66MyJW31DsgkK
|
||||||
|
E1aDmxANAjEEyKfU6X53Qj5kGzMNrOY+6bFz7VZbxVlVEnURjnSYcNmgtywTRxsA
|
||||||
|
Z4JGhtAz9fwpAjEBs5I5adCIv7hC5jmtDTlbYEvepIRPu7vlFxPd4+dpmwl/kLB6
|
||||||
|
6UO1U5XLxyraxdBb
|
||||||
|
-----END PRIVATE KEY-----
|
BIN
tests/data_files/rsa_pkcs1_784_clear.der
Normal file
BIN
tests/data_files/rsa_pkcs1_784_clear.der
Normal file
Binary file not shown.
13
tests/data_files/rsa_pkcs1_784_clear.pem
Normal file
13
tests/data_files/rsa_pkcs1_784_clear.pem
Normal file
@ -0,0 +1,13 @@
|
|||||||
|
-----BEGIN PRIVATE KEY-----
|
||||||
|
MIIB7QIBADANBgkqhkiG9w0BAQEFAASCAdcwggHTAgEAAmMAvbHZtyhktEvbWBdx
|
||||||
|
axUmmPLrlPu3qWyD/uWhht5mggzVgJuA5rCPdzZuSJOhzneTWyJeldIvN0jI8K+z
|
||||||
|
tOb2rWY0eLikyaI5T/j3BcpnMSvz6Igwdd8ZXHKxsixyH/Wb/JMCAwEAAQJiGxeb
|
||||||
|
kJ0kRNvQp/QxLqoGqTGIk+6ffIMTFwSU3T5GRayvkX6kGk59LvmHJrZvFZ3eXZbI
|
||||||
|
QDclNOS96CGaw7LdTM8L8iFAsYVg6xGDqJrJ+VRU5sOut2ZcvTKwjZXhrTvvQwEC
|
||||||
|
MgDd9eo/pDyuDlYTZF10V4AZhOZ9oNT1EYfx57jDSQhNNc6vbdYcSAhi6ykowHTW
|
||||||
|
C+D5AjIA2skwnxXPAl16rbwpIFMK1BrAsYeZfPOxpKIPXiGMQNCdVOQERYyG1vK5
|
||||||
|
2bQ1eO446wIxePaABtb2ytS9TCwyUiktgrrO8kAoTraTI95o7uRqRcnBLhHp0dff
|
||||||
|
2ijWcYMRKWWn4QIyAMoS9yCIcRm7I1siJk4fxSmgyAdwufhp0NLBiDYmADfBNv+4
|
||||||
|
VqWyJLyVlciZJKZcSR8CMTfLvGlWObOndbb+I1IrAFZM4vK7TopDTeBAS2+5fIST
|
||||||
|
o3H7yyLP1EfKMqdEvgfNEz0=
|
||||||
|
-----END PRIVATE KEY-----
|
Loading…
x
Reference in New Issue
Block a user